During the Industrial Revolution, coal became the preferred fuel over wood due to its higher energy density and availability. Coal could produce more heat and power steam engines more efficiently than wood, making it ideal for fueling factories and locomotives. Additionally, as deforestation progressed and wood became scarcer in urban areas, coal provided a more reliable and abundant energy source to support rapid industrialization and urban growth.

Coal is the most widely used fossil fuel because it is relatively abundant, inexpensive, and has a high energy content. It is also easy to transport and store, making it a convenient option for power generation and industrial processes. Additionally, coal reserves are distributed worldwide, further contributing to its widespread use.
Coal is a solid fossil fuel that is mined from the earth and used for energy production, while coal tar is a black, sticky substance produced during the distillation of coal. Coal is primarily used for energy production, while coal tar is used in various industrial applications, such as in the production of pavement sealants and in the manufacturing of chemicals.
